Herramienta gratuita
Generador de Factura Electrónica XML
Genera el XML de factura en el formato oficial del SRI Ecuador. 100% local, sin servidores. Nota: El XML debe ser firmado electrónicamente con tu certificado .p12 antes de enviarlo al SRI.
Datos del emisor
Datos del comprador
Detalle de productos / servicios
Descripción
Cantidad
P. Unitario
Descuento %
IVA
Preguntas frecuentes
¿Cómo generar una factura electrónica para el SRI?
Completa los datos del emisor (RUC, razón social, dirección), del comprador (tipo y número de identificación, nombre), agrega los productos o servicios con cantidades y precios, y presiona "Generar XML". El sistema creará automáticamente el XML con la clave de acceso de 49 dígitos.
¿Qué es la clave de acceso de una factura electrónica?
La clave de acceso es un número de 49 dígitos que identifica de forma única cada comprobante electrónico. Contiene la fecha, tipo de documento, RUC del emisor, ambiente, establecimiento, punto de emisión, secuencial, un código numérico aleatorio y un dígito verificador calculado con módulo 11.
¿Necesito firmar el XML antes de enviarlo al SRI?
Sí. El XML generado por esta herramienta es el comprobante sin firma. Antes de enviarlo al SRI para autorización, debes firmarlo electrónicamente con tu certificado .p12 emitido por el Banco Central del Ecuador (BCE) u otra entidad certificadora autorizada.
¿Puedo enviar el XML directamente al SRI con esta herramienta?
No. Esta herramienta cubre la fase de generación del XML. Para el flujo completo necesitas: 1) Generar el XML (lo que hace esta herramienta), 2) Firmar con certificado .p12, 3) Enviar al web service del SRI, 4) Recibir la autorización.
¿El XML generado cumple con las normas del SRI?
Sí, el XML se genera según el formato oficial de comprobantes electrónicos del SRI Ecuador (versión 1.0.0). Usa los códigos correctos de IVA (código 4 para 15%, código 0 para 0%), formas de pago según la ficha técnica, y calcula la clave de acceso con el algoritmo oficial de módulo 11.